Understanding Variance and Return to Player (RTP)

A critical concept for any aspiring gambler to grasp is the idea of variance, often referred to as volatility. This refers to the degree of risk associated with a particular game. High-variance games offer the potential for large payouts but come with extended periods of losses. Low-variance games provide more frequent, smaller wins. Your preference should align with your risk tolerance and bankroll size. If you have a limited bankroll, sticking to lower-variance games can help you extend your playtime and minimize the risk of quickly depleting your funds. Understanding the mathematical edge the house has in each game is also important.

Alongside variance, Return to Player (RTP) is another essential metric. RTP represents the percentage of all wagered money that a game is expected to return to players over a long period. A higher RTP generally indicates a more favorable game for the player. However, it’s important to remember that RTP is a theoretical average calculated over millions of spins. In the short term, your results may deviate significantly from the stated RTP. Always research the RTP of a game before playing, and prioritize those with higher percentages. Websites dedicated to casino reviews often provide comprehensive RTP information for a wide range of games.

The Importance of Responsible Gambling

Before diving into the details of specific strategies, it's essential to address the importance of responsible gambling. Gambling should always be viewed as a form of entertainment, not a source of income. Set a budget before you start playing and stick to it, no matter what. Never chase your losses, as this can quickly lead to financial ruin. If you find yourself gambling more than you can afford to lose, or if gambling is negatively impacting your life, seek help immediately. There are numerous resources available to support problem gamblers, including helplines, support groups, and online resources.

Bankroll Management Techniques

Effective bankroll management is arguably the most important skill a gambler can develop. It’s the practice of carefully controlling your betting amounts to minimize risk and extend your playtime. A common rule of thumb is to never bet more than a small percentage of your bankroll on a single wager. The specific percentage will depend on your risk tolerance, but 1-5% is a reasonable range for most players. For example, if you have a bankroll of £100, you should aim to bet no more than £1-£5 per wager. This helps to protect your funds from being wiped out by a single losing streak.

Another important technique is to set win and loss limits. Before you start playing, decide how much you’re willing to win or lose. Once you reach either of those limits, stop playing, regardless of how tempting it may be to continue. This helps to prevent emotional decision-making and ensures that you stick to your pre-defined plan. Remember that losses are an inevitable part of gambling, and it’s crucial to accept them as such. Don’t try to recoup your losses by increasing your bets; this is a classic mistake that often leads to even greater losses.

Progressive Betting Systems: Proceed with Caution

You’ll encounter various progressive betting systems online, like the Martingale, Fibonacci, and D'Alembert. These systems involve adjusting your bet size based on previous outcomes. While they may seem appealing in theory, they are often flawed and can quickly deplete your bankroll, especially during prolonged losing streaks. The Martingale system, for example, involves doubling your bet after each loss, with the aim of recouping all previous losses with a single win. However, this requires an exponentially increasing bankroll, and you'll eventually reach a point where your bet exceeds the table limits or your available funds.

While understanding these systems can be valuable for academic purposes, it's generally advisable to avoid using them in practice. A consistent, conservative approach to bankroll management is far more likely to yield long-term results than relying on complex and often unreliable betting strategies. Leveraging Bonuses and Promotions

Online casinos frequently off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and reward loyal customers. These can include welcome bonuses, deposit bonuses, free spins, and cashback offers. While bonuses can provide a boost to your bankroll, it’s essential to understand their terms and conditions before accepting them. Many bonuses come with wagering requirements, which specify the amount of money you need to wager before you can withdraw any winnings.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means you need to wager 30 times the bonus amount before you can cash out.

Pay close attention to the game restrictions associated with bonuses. Some bonuses may only be valid for specific games, while others may contribute less towards the wagering requirement. Understanding these restrictions will help you maximize the value of the bonus and avoid any frustration down the line. It’s also important to be aware of the time limits associated with bonuses. Most bonuses have an expiration date, so you need to meet the wagering requirements within a specified timeframe. Taking the time to read the fine print can save you from disappointment and ensure you get the most out of your bonus.

Understanding Game Weighting

When it comes to wagering requirements, different games often contribute different percentages towards fulfilling them. This is known as game weighting. Typically, slots contribute 100% to the wagering requirement, meaning that every £1 you bet on a slot counts as £1 towards meeting the requirement. However, table games like blackjack and roulette often contribute only 10-20%, or even less. This means that you need to wager significantly more on these games to clear the bonus. Be aware of these weighting rules when choosing games to play with a bonus.
